Mr Matthew Jefferies is a consultant urological and robotic surgeon based at Nuffield Health The Vale Hospital in Wales. He specialises in a broad range of urological conditions, with expertise in benign prostatic hyperplasia (BPH), prostate cancer screening and treatment, and kidney cancer. Mr Jefferies also offers advanced treatments using laparoscopy and robotic surgery. His extensive experience covers both male and female urological conditions, allowing him to provide comprehensive care tailored to individual needs.
He graduated in 2006 from the University of Wales College of Medicine and completed his urological training in South Wales. Alongside his clinical work, Mr Jefferies has a strong background in research. He earned a PhD in prostate cancer genetics from Cardiff University in 2012, enhancing his ability to offer the latest evidence-based care. As an honorary senior lecturer at Swansea University Medical School, he contributes to the education of future urologists.
Mr Jefferies offers a wide range of diagnostic and treatment services, including prostate surgery, prostate screening (MRI and Tranperineal prostate biopsy), insertion of peri-rectal spacers prior to radiotherapy, cystoscopy, and penoscrotal procedures (circumcision, hydrocele repair, epididymal cyst excision). He is experienced in minimally invasive procedures like aquablation therapy, TURP (prostate resection), and vasectomy. Mr Jefferies is a Fellow of the Royal College of Surgeons of England and a member of the British Association of Urological Surgeons and the European Association of Urology, ensuring that he remains at the forefront of advancements in urology.
